|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.apache.myfaces.custom.schedule.model.Day
public class Day
This class represents a day in the Schedule component
| Constructor Summary | |
|---|---|
Day(java.util.Date date)
Creates a new Day object. |
|
Day(java.util.Date date,
java.util.TimeZone timeZone)
Creates a new Day object. |
|
| Method Summary | |
|---|---|
void |
addInterval(java.lang.String label,
java.util.Date startTime,
java.util.Date endTime)
|
int |
compareTo(java.lang.Object o)
|
boolean |
equals(java.lang.Object o)
|
boolean |
equalsDate(java.util.Date date)
Check if the specified date is on this day |
protected java.util.Calendar |
getCalendarInstance(java.util.Date date)
|
java.util.Date |
getDate()
|
java.util.Date |
getDayEnd()
|
java.util.Date |
getDayStart()
|
java.util.TreeSet |
getIntervals()
|
java.lang.String |
getSpecialDayName()
If this day is a holiday of some kind, this gets the name |
int |
hashCode()
|
boolean |
isWorkingDay()
Is this day a working day? |
void |
setIntervals(java.util.Collection intervals)
Set user defined intervals during the day. |
void |
setSpecialDayName(java.lang.String specialDayName)
If this day is a holiday of some kind, this sets the name |
void |
setWorkingDay(boolean workingDay)
Is this day a working day? |
| Methods inherited from class java.lang.Object |
|---|
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public Day(java.util.Date date)
date - the date
java.lang.NullPointerException - when the date is null
public Day(java.util.Date date,
java.util.TimeZone timeZone)
date - the datetimeZone - The timezone
java.lang.NullPointerException - when the date is null| Method Detail |
|---|
protected java.util.Calendar getCalendarInstance(java.util.Date date)
public java.util.Date getDate()
public java.util.Date getDayEnd()
public java.util.Date getDayStart()
public void setSpecialDayName(java.lang.String specialDayName)
If this day is a holiday of some kind, this sets the name
specialDayName - The specialDayName to set.public java.lang.String getSpecialDayName()
If this day is a holiday of some kind, this gets the name
public void setWorkingDay(boolean workingDay)
Is this day a working day?
workingDay - The workingDay to set.public boolean isWorkingDay()
Is this day a working day?
public java.util.TreeSet getIntervals()
public void setIntervals(java.util.Collection intervals)
intervals - A Collection
public void addInterval(java.lang.String label,
java.util.Date startTime,
java.util.Date endTime)
public int compareTo(java.lang.Object o)
compareTo in interface java.lang.ComparableComparable.compareTo(java.lang.Object)public boolean equals(java.lang.Object o)
equals in class java.lang.ObjectObject.equals(java.lang.Object)public boolean equalsDate(java.util.Date date)
Check if the specified date is on this day
date - the date to check
public int hashCode()
hashCode in class java.lang.ObjectObject.hashCode()
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||